Amuniabaulghai - Sanakhemundi, Ganjam
Amuniabaulghai is a village situated in the Sanakhemundi tehsil of Ganjam district, Odisha. It is located approximately 35 km from Hinjili and around 55 km from Chatrapur. Kauddia serves as the Gram Panchayat for Amuniabaulghai village.
As per Census 2011, the village code of Amuniabaulghai is 412300. The village covers a total geographical area of 38 hectares and falls under the 761102 pincode. Hinjilicut is the nearest town, located about 11 km away.
Amuniabaulghai village is governed under the Panchayati Raj system, with a Sarpanch serving as the elected head. For political representation, the village falls under the Sanakhemundi Vidhan Sabha (Assembly) constituency and the Aska Lok Sabha (Parliamentary) constituency.
Population of Amuniabaulghai
As per Census 2011, Amuniabaulghai village has a total population of 1,148 people, consisting of 602 males and 546 females. The village has 199 households and a sex ratio of 906 females per 1,000 males. There are 184 children in the 0–6 years age group. The village has 669 literate and 479 illiterate residents. Additionally, 60 people belong to Scheduled Caste (SC) communities.
Detailed gender-wise population figures for Amuniabaulghai are given below:
| Category | Total | Male | Female |
|---|---|---|---|
| Total Population | 1,148 | 602 | 546 |
| Child Population (0–6 yrs) | 184 | 101 | 83 |
| Scheduled Castes (SC) | 60 | 24 | 36 |
| Literate Population | 669 | 405 | 264 |
| Illiterate Population | 479 | 197 | 282 |

Transport and Connectivity of Amuniabaulghai
Amuniabaulghai is connected by an all-weather road, and public transport is mainly available through shared auto-rickshaws.
| Connectivity | Status | Nearest Availability |
|---|---|---|
| Public Bus Service | No | Available within >10 km |
| Private Bus Service | No | Available within <5 km |
| Railway Station | No | - |
In addition to basic transport facilities, distances and travel times help define overall connectivity. The road distance from Hinjilicut to Amuniabaulghai is about 11 km, with a usual travel time of around 30-60 minutes. Similarly, the road distance from Chatrapur to Amuniabaulghai is about 55 km, with the usual travel time around ~1.6 hours.
